The opportunity

As Area Manager for USA, Canada and South East Asia you will be responsible for getting the best deals at the target quality for our land services.  You will use your social skills to foster relationships with existing suppliers and develop new ones and will apply your analytical skills to set and manage budgets, being always conscious of offering the best customer experience.

 

Your responsibilities will include, but not be limited to:

  • Negotiating contracts with hotels, restaurants, and tourist attractions
  • Prospecting and identifying new business partners within your region
  • Budget-setting and budget accountability at the end of the fiscal year
  • Product development. This includes developing new tours and improving existing itineraries
  • Settling accounts with your suppliers
  • Quality-control

Go Ahead Tours offers international and domestic group tour opportunities for adults of all ages. Our fully escorted tours present the most beautiful, intriguing, and delightful places around the world, at just the right pace.  Travelers choose from a variety of tour types, including food and wine tours, safaris, land and sea, and short city-stays.
